abstract = "Properties of porous silicon obtained by electrochemical etching
were studied using different current densities and hydrofluoric
acid solutions in order to obtain a periodic structure of thin
layers to produce Bragg reflectors in the visible region of the
spectrum. RESUMO: Propriedades do sil{\'{\i}}cio poroso obtido
